The email marketing page


Todays eBay Tip:


The email marketing newsletter is THE key to repeat business if using eBay tools. The basic store offers more emails than you would probably ever need, 5000 a month, and is a great way to get a fan base started.


Some cool sales I have seen are:

Anniversary Sale: free shipping

Two for Tuesday:buy two get free shipping

eBays Birthday: Buy two get one free

National Ham Sandwich Day: get half off of your second purchase if you ate a ham sandwich today


Any reason is great. Your emails should be brief and to the point.

Wording on your description page

Todays eBay Tip:

Remember that most of the time you have about three seconds of reading on your description page. It's important to catch your buyers attention and not waste it on mundane information. If you have too much information at the beginning and not enough pictures, your buyer WILL NOT read the rest.

Seperate your description page with upclose pictures of the product to keep your readers attention for the rest of your text

Detailed Seller Ratings:


The Stars that are now a part of the feedback may soon come to be a big part of the eBay shopping experience. Starting now in the UK the auctions will be displayed by best DSR scores first. In particular, the best shipping experience first.


This is the time before the new year starts to get your DSR scores up as high as you can. There may be some great things coming for those who have high scores in this area.


eBay has mentioned that they really want to increase the incentives to the good sellers. And as eBay feels these Detailed Seller Ratings are the best thing yet to determine good sellers, I would highly recommend getting these scores up quickl

More email marketing!!! If you haven't tried the email marketing in the stores section of eBay, you are missing out on some great repeat business. The email marketing links are easy to set up and if you offer items like free shipping, or a discount for your current customers you are going to retain your business. Also including a sale on your invoices like "Free Shipping on any order made in the next 5 days" Is a great way to get more repeat business, and maintain customer loyalty.

eBay TIP OF THE DAY:

eBay has a new initiate that restricts members who have negative or nuetral feedback that is 5% of the total feedback over a 90 day peroid. If you receive any negative or neutral feedbacks MUTUALLY WITHDRAW them as soon as possible. The restriction is very hard to get out of, so respond to your buyers negative or neutral feedback as quickly as possible.

visit Toolhaus.org to see how close you are to being restricted or to see how close a seller that you are buying from is to being restricted. It is a free site, and very helpful!
